Tue Aug 18, 2026 · 17:00
County Board
County Board to vote on $60.3M bond sale, jail and courthouse contracts
The Portage County Board will consider resolutions including the sale of $60,305,000 in general obligation promissory notes, contract amendments for the courthouse remodel and new jail project, and adoption of the 2027-2032 Capital Improvement Plan. The board will also vote on appointments to several committees and approve budget amendments and transfers.
- Resolution awarding sale of $60,305,000 General Obligation Promissory Notes, Series 2026A
- Contract amendment with J.H. Findorff & Son Inc. for Phase 1 Courthouse Remodel Project
- Contract amendment with J.H. Findorff & Son Inc. for Bid Package 2 (Mass Grading and Utilities) for New Jail and Law Enforcement Center
- Adoption of Portage County 2027-2032 Capital Improvement Plan
- Addition of 32-hour/week Energy Sustainability Specialist position partially funded by Focus on Energy grants
budgetbondscapital-improvementconstructionappointmentsordinancesjailcourthouse
✓ Decided: County Board approves $60.3M borrowing, adopts multiple plans and contracts
The Portage County Board of Supervisors approved a $60,305,000 general obligation promissory note sale, adopted the Bicycle and Pedestrian Plan, Comprehensive Safety Action Plan, and 2027-2032 Capital Improvement Plan, and authorized contract amendments with J.H. Findorff & Son for courthouse and jail projects. The board also approved a new Energy Sustainability Specialist position and several other resolutions, with one appointment referred back to committee.
- Approved $60,305,000 general obligation promissory notes, Series 2026A (voice vote, no negatives)
- Adopted amended Resolution 23-2026-2028 adding citizen member to Land and Water Conservation Committee (18-5-1)
- Adopted Town of Hull comprehensive plan and zoning map amendment for parcels 020240822-09.04 and .09.05 (voice vote, no negatives)
- Adopted Portage County Bicycle and Pedestrian Plan (voice vote, no negatives)
- Adopted Portage County Comprehensive Safety Action Plan (voice vote, 1 nay)
- Approved contract amendment with J.H. Findorff & Son for courthouse remodel Phase 1 (voice vote, no negatives)
- Approved contract amendment with J.H. Findorff & Son for jail and law enforcement center Bid Package 2 (voice vote, no negatives)
- Approved Delta Dental as voluntary dental insurance provider for 2027-2028 (voice vote, no negatives)

Wed Aug 12, 2026 · 15:30
Housing Authority Board of Commissioners
Housing Authority to consider exiting federal affordable housing program
The Portage County Housing Authority Board will discuss and possibly vote on resolutions to exit the Rural Development Section 515 affordable housing program by prepaying a loan, along with related funding and financial account changes. The board will also review routine items like minutes, cash disbursements, and a director's update, and may enter closed session for personnel and investment discussions.
- Resolution 26-02: Exiting Rural Development Section 515 program with loan prepayment
- Resolution 26-03: Outside source funding for loan prepayment
- Resolution 26-04: All financial account transfer authorization
- Resolution 26-05: Revised utility allowance chart for Housing Choice Voucher program
- Resolution 26-06: Updates to Housing Choice Voucher Administrative Plan
housingaffordable-housingrural-developmentbudgetvoucherspersonnel
✓ Decided: Housing board approves $112,679.88 in April disbursements
The Housing Authority Board of Commissioners approved $112,679.88 in disbursements for April 2026. The board also approved the minutes from the May 13, 2026 meeting and entered closed session to discuss housing complexes and staff, taking action on one item. The next meeting was scheduled for July 8, 2026.
- Approved the May 13, 2026 meeting minutes as presented.
- Approved Housing Authority disbursements for April 2026 totaling $112,679.88.
- Entered closed session under Wis. Stat. 19.85(1)(c) to discuss housing complexes and staff.
- Directed the Executive Director to continue communications with Rural Development regarding low-income housing complexes.
- Took no action on the closed session item regarding Housing Authority staff.
- Approved the next meeting date of July 8, 2026 at 4:00 p.m. at the Housing Authority office.

Thu Aug 6, 2026 · 08:30
Local Emergency Planning Committee (LEPC)
Portage County LEPC to elect officers and set 2026-2028 meeting schedule
The Portage County Local Emergency Planning Committee will convene to elect a chair and vice chair, choose its regular meeting date for the 2026–2028 term, and receive reports on hazardous materials response, training, and grant funding. Members will also review and possibly act on hazardous materials response claims, off-site plans for local facilities, and updates to the county’s hazardous materials strategic plan.
- Elect chairperson and vice chairperson
- Set regular meeting date for 2026–2028 term
- Review and possible approval of hazardous materials response claims
- Review and possible approval of off-site plans for Charter Communications, Ingredion Plant #2, KI Mobility, Lineage Logistics, R.R. Donnelley, Stevens Point Brewery, UNFI Distribution Co, Wilbur Ellis Co, Wisconsin Central LTD, Worzalla Inc.
- Review and possible approval of LEPC by-laws
emergency-planninghazardous-materialsgrantspublic-safetystevens-point
✓ Decided: LEPC elects new chair, approves off-site plans and by-laws
The Portage County Local Emergency Planning Committee elected Tanner Arnold as Chairperson and Emma Baumhofer as Vice Chairperson for the 2026-2028 term. The committee approved off-site plans for ten facilities, including Charter Communications and Stevens Point Brewery, and approved the LEPC By-laws, which designates Wisconsin Emergency Management as the compliance inspector. The next regular meeting is set for November 5, 2026.
- Elected Tanner Arnold as Chairperson (voice vote, no negatives)
- Elected Emma Baumhofer as Vice Chairperson (voice vote, no negatives)
- Approved off-site plans for 10 facilities (voice vote, no negatives)
- Approved LEPC By-laws (voice vote, no negatives)
- Approved February 5, 2026 meeting minutes (voice vote, no negatives)
- Set regular meetings quarterly on 1st Thursday of Feb, May, Aug, Nov at 8:30am

Tue Jul 28, 2026 · 16:30
Solid Waste Management Board
Board to discuss contingency plan for deer carcass dumpsters
The Solid Waste Management Board will receive reports on landfill, hazardous waste, and recycling processing. The board will discuss and possibly act on a contingency plan if federal funding for deer carcass dumpsters is unavailable.
- Contingency plan for deer carcass dumpsters regarding federal funding
- Landfill, Special Program, and Hazardous Waste updates
- SWAP Reconciliation and Recycling Processing Report
waste-managementrecyclingfederal-fundinglandfill
✓ Decided: Board authorizes fees for deer carcass dumpsters
The Board approved a contingency plan for deer carcass disposal in the event federal funding is unavailable. This includes placing a dumpster onsite and implementing specific user fees.
- Approved May meeting minutes (voice vote, 0 negative)
- Authorized staff to place a deer carcass dumpster onsite and implement fees not to exceed $200 per ton with a minimum charge of up to $10 per vehicle (voice vote, 1 negative)
